There are 6 six essential elements of geography. The geography is known as a science that deals with the distribution, description,  and interaction of aspects like cultural, physical and biological.

Geography is not just mapping, in fact, geography does not just study physical aspects of the environment. There are six essential elements studied by the geography:

1 - The world in spatial terms:

  • Deals with the way we use geographic representations like maps.
  • Relates the spacial terms with people, places, and environments.
  • Deals with the spatial distribution of people around the earth's surface.

2 - Places and Regions:

  • It's related to the particular physical and human characteristics of the places, creating a relationship between the people and the environment, cultural and political aspects.

3 - Physical Systems:

  • It's more related to the spacial/physical distribution of the different ecosystems on the earth.

4 - Human systems:

  • It's related to human factors like distribution, migration, characteristics on the earth.
  • The characteristics of population conflicts,  economic patterns, and cultural aspects.

5 -  Environment and society:

  • It relates the human society characteristics to the environment, with information about how humans affect physical environments and the opposite.
  • The interaction between the society and the environmental resources distribution, uses and exploitation.

6 - Uses of geography:

  • Studies the physical environments changes in order to know about the past characteristics and how the environment will change in the future.

Unlike many other arts in western and central Africa, pottery typically is done by women. African potters were used for different purposes from decorative to culinary reasons. The pots were created differently depending on the origins of their different traditions and associated dietary and religious customs.
